概括
使用阿皮克萨班治疗心房动会带来出血风险. 一名患者在鼻腔包装后发展出MRSA细菌病和骨质炎,突出了一个罕见的并发症.

背景情况:
- 阿皮克萨班是一种直接的XA因子抑制剂,广泛用于预防心房动中风.
- 虽然与华法林相比,阿皮克萨班的出血风险较低,但它仍然会导致出血并发症,如表观症.
- 鼻腔膜往往是通过鼻腔封装来管理的,这是一种可能引入感染风险的程序.
研究的目的:
- 报告一例罕见的甲基西林耐药黄金葡萄球菌 (MRSA) 细菌病和随后的脊椎骨髓炎病例,该病例发生在接受阿皮克萨班治疗的患者鼻包装后.
- 为了强调鼻塞后远程感染的可能性,即使在接受抗凝药的患者中也是如此.
- 强调在慢性疼痛恶化的患者中考虑感染的重要性.
主要方法:
- 一个75岁的妇女接受了阿皮克萨班的病例报告.
- 经过鼻包装管理的表症的文档.
- 对MRSA细菌病和L2-L3脊椎骨髓炎的诊断.
主要成果:
- 患者在鼻腔包装用于表皮术后发展出MRSA细菌性病.
- MRSA 细菌病导致 L2-L3 脊椎骨质炎的发展.
- 患者经历了背部疼痛的恶化,这是骨髓炎的症状.
结论:
- 鼻子包装用于表术可能是远程骨髓炎的罕见来源,即使在服用阿皮克萨班的患者中也是如此.
- 医疗保健提供者应警鼻塞后的传染性并发症.
- 服用抗凝血药的患者慢性疼痛的变化需要对潜在原因进行彻底评估,包括感染.

Epistaxis
514
Epistaxis, or nosebleeds, occurs when small, swollen blood vessels in the nasal mucous membrane rupture. Typically, the anterior septum is the primary site of occurrence.

Blood and Nerve Supply to the Bones
13.5K
Bones are dynamic organs that require a rich supply of oxygen and nutrients. Around 5% to 10% of the cardiac output supplies blood to the bones. A typical long bone has three main sources: the nutrient artery, the metaphyseal and epiphyseal arteries, and the periosteal arteries.
